Princess Charlene and Prince Albert of Monaco were a picture of unity at the launch of a new boat for the Monaco maritime police.
Newly released photos from their joint engagement, which took place last week, follow months of speculation about the state of their marriage.
The couple posed for photos with Albert’s niece, Charlotte Casiraghi, 37, eleventh in line to the Monaco throne and daughter of Princess Caroline.
Albert, 65, and Charlene, 45, were coordinated in navy and white suits with nautical accents.

It was one of several outings by the Monegasque royal family who were spotted at numerous engagements last month.
The boat they inaugurated, the Saint Georges shuttle, is the latest addition to the police fleet.
Capable of reaching 45 knots, it will be useful for sea rescues and other missions.
Last week, Princess Charlene attempted to quell persistent rumors that her marriage to Prince Albert was in jeopardy, calling them “exhausting”.
Apparently keen to be seen together, this latest engagement is one of several joint outings undertaken by Prince Albert and Princess Charlene in recent days.
She only recently returned to Monaco after a solo visit to South Africa, her native country.
The trip marked her first visit to the country where she grew up since 2021.
During that visit, she suffered a serious illness that kept her away from her husband and eight-year-old twins for several months because she could not fly.

In a previous interview with Italian newspaper Corriere della Sierra, Albert said: “I don’t understand all these rumors, which hurt me, about us… they are lies.”
For her part, Charlène claims to be “serene and happy” in her marriage, denying rumors appearing in the German and French media according to which she “now lives in Switzerland” and that her marriage was “ceremonial”.
Speaking to South African newspaper News24 ahead of her return last month, the princess, who shares twins Jacques and Gabriella with Prince Albert, said: “I find the rumors (about my marriage) tiring and exhausting.”
